Trade group: BioShield II bill needed, but without patent extensions
November 18th, 2005
The Coalition for a Competitive Pharmaceutical Market (CCPM) said the excessive patent extensions and market exclusivities being considered in Senate BioShield legislation would drive up healthcare costs for employers, health insurers, and consumers. To highlight its concerns with this legislation, which CCPM says contains harmful intellectual property (IP) provisions, CCPM is running print ads in the Washington, DC market.
